> > I am getting frequent messages in cache.log. What does this mean?
> >
> > 2001/08/03 21:47:44| ctx: enter level 0:
'http://10.1.130.6:18256/w050a4108.60d
> > 50625:7ffffe81/t01/_00001808.gif'
> > 2001/08/03 21:47:44| ctx: enter level 207784792: '(null)'
>
> Its a debugging message designed to help coders track down bugs in
> the HTTP code. The ctx stuff is only used by the HTTP code - whenever
> there's some debugging between the ctx enter and exit code, you get
> the above (well the first line) to help you identify which url/request
> the debugging is for.
